r13664: Fix the cli_error codes to always detect a socket error.
This code needs a tidyup and common code with libsmb/errormap.c merging. Should fix the winbindd crash Jerry found (I hope). Jeremy. (This used to be commit e81227d044fbe7c73c121e540ccafc7f6517c4ea)
